A new survey commissioned by Age UK reveals that three-quarters of adults between 50 and 65 worry about staying healthy as they age, and two-thirds fear that they will lose their independence as they get older.
Inactivity tends to creep in gradually, and the less we use it, the more we lose it.” That’s why Age UK has launched its Act Now, Age Better campaign.
With the backing of England’s chief medical officer Prof Chris Whitty and Age UK ambassador Helen Mirren, it encourages everyone to “move better for a later life”.
